Fair Oaks sits on that South Cobb clay base that a lot of homeowners underestimate. Clay drainage is slower, which actually works in your favor for a putting green—standing water isn't ideal, but our base prep accounts for that. Lot sizes in Fair Oaks vary quite a bit depending on whether you're in the tighter residential sections or toward the Mableton transitional areas, so we size greens to match what you've actually got available. Sun exposure is typically decent across most Fair Oaks yards, though some properties back up to wooded areas. That shade pattern matters because it affects turf wear patterns and how the green plays throughout the day. We've learned that Fair Oaks residents tend to prefer greens that blend naturally into their existing landscaping rather than looking like a bright commercial installation. The clay soil also means we always recommend proper base preparation—it's not optional if you want drainage and longevity. Your yard's specific slope and existing grading will determine how we approach installation.
Clay itself doesn't degrade the turf, but poor drainage does. That's why we focus heavily on base prep in Fair Oaks. Proper gravel and sand layering compensates for clay's drainage limitations. When it's done right, you're looking at 10-15 years of solid performance, regardless of what's underneath.
We back our turf with a 10-year manufacturer's warranty on the synthetic fiber and a 5-year labor warranty on seams and workmanship. Fair Oaks customers appreciate knowing exactly what's covered before we break ground. We'll walk you through the specifics during your consultation.
Absolutely. Modern synthetic turf performs in partial shade better than real grass ever could. If your yard is dappled by trees or neighbors' structures, we'll recommend a turf blend that handles that lighting. Full sun greens and shade greens have slightly different specifications.
Price depends on size, site prep needs, and whether your clay requires extra drainage work. Most Fair Oaks projects run 3,000 to 8,000 dollars installed. We provide detailed estimates after measuring your space and assessing soil conditions—no guessing.
